Types of Eye Cancer
Several types exist, each with distinct characteristics:
- Uveal Melanomas: These include iris, ciliary body, and choroidal melanomas. Choroidal melanomas are the most common.
- Retinoblastoma: Primarily affects children under five.
- Orbital/Adnexal Cancers: Include squamous cell carcinoma and rhabdomyosarcoma.
How Common is Eye Cancer?
In the U.S., approximately 3,400 cases are diagnosed annually. Among these, 2,500 are choroidal melanomas. While rare, awareness of symptoms and timely consultation with a specialist can improve outcomes.

Common Signs to Watch For
Early indicators often include blurred vision, floaters, or dark spots on the iris. These changes may seem minor but should not be ignored. For choroidal melanomas, light flashes or persistent blurriness are common.
Advanced cases may present with eye pain, redness, or swelling. In severe instances, bulging or displacement of the eye can occur. Vision loss is a critical sign that requires immediate attention.

Initial Consultation and Tests
The first step often includes a detailed patient history review and a dilated eye exam. These help the specialist identify any visible abnormalities. Imaging tools like ultrasound and OCT are used to map the tumor’s size and location.
In some cases, fluorescein angiography may be employed to visualize blood flow in the eye. These tests provide critical insights into the condition’s extent and help guide further steps.

These check for metastasis, ensuring the cancer cells haven’t spread to other parts of the body. MRI or CT scans are also used for detailed imaging.
Biopsies are generally avoided in uveal melanomas due to the risk of spreading the tumor. Instead, non-invasive methods are preferred for safer and more accurate results.

Non-Surgical Treatments
For small-to-medium melanomas, radiation therapy is often the preferred option. Techniques like plaque brachytherapy involve placing a radioactive implant near the tumor. This method achieves a 90% local control rate, making it highly effective.
Proton beam therapy is another advanced option, targeting tumors with precision while sparing healthy tissue. These non-invasive treatments are ideal for patients who wish to preserve vision and avoid surgical risks.
When Surgery is Necessary
Large tumors or cases involving vision loss may require surgery. Enucleation, the removal of the affected eye, is sometimes necessary to prevent further complications. Types of Ocular Surgeries
Several surgical options are available for managing ocular tumors:
- Iridectomy/Iridocyclectomy: These procedures target tumors in the iris or ciliary body, preserving as much healthy tissue as possible.
- Enucleation: This involves removing the entire eyeball, often followed by placing an implant to maintain the socket’s structure.
- Orbital Exenteration: In advanced cases, this radical procedure removes the eye, eyelid, and surrounding tissue. It’s rare but necessary for aggressive tumors.

Potential Complications
Surgical interventions for ocular conditions carry certain risks. Common complications include infection, bleeding, and reactions to anesthesia. In cases of enucleation, immediate vision loss is unavoidable, while partial vision loss may occur with resection surgeries.
Another concern is the risk of cancer recurrence. Eye-sparing surgeries, while preserving vision, may have a higher recurrence rate. Adjuvant radiation therapy is often used to mitigate this risk. Monitoring for recurrence is essential, with a 5-year survival rate of 80% for localized cases.

Recovery and Life After Eye Cancer Surgery
Recovering from ocular procedures involves both physical and emotional adjustments. Patients are typically discharged within 1-2 days, with a conformer placed in the eye socket to maintain its shape. Prosthetic fitting occurs 4-6 weeks post-surgery, restoring appearance and confidence.
Adapting to changes in depth perception can take 6-12 months. Occupational therapy and specialized exercises help patients regain functionality. Regular follow-ups with a healthcare team are essential, including annual eye exams and systemic scans to monitor for any complications.
Emotional support plays a crucial role in recovery. Counseling and peer groups provide a safe space to address trauma and share experiences. Many patients report a high quality of life after adapting to their artificial eye, proving that recovery is both possible and empowering.
